Strategic Partnership Models: Frameworks for Digital Health Success
1. Startup-Health System Innovation Partnerships
The most common and often most successful digital health partnerships involve collaboration between innovative startups and established healthcare delivery organizations:
Innovation Lab Partnerships: Healthcare systems creating dedicated innovation spaces where startups can develop, test, and refine solutions with direct access to clinical workflows, patient populations, and healthcare provider feedback.
Pilot Program Integration: Structured programs that enable startups to implement solutions within healthcare system operations while providing clinical validation, user feedback, and real-world performance data essential for solution refinement and market credibility.
Co-Development Initiatives: Collaborative development programs where healthcare systems contribute clinical expertise, regulatory knowledge, and patient insights while startups provide technological innovation and development capabilities.
Revenue Sharing Models: Partnership structures that align incentives through shared financial outcomes, enabling startups to access healthcare system resources while healthcare organizations benefit from successful digital health implementations.

3. Payer-Provider-Technology Convergence Partnerships
The most sophisticated digital health partnerships involve three-way collaborations between payers, providers, and technology companies:
Value-Based Care Integration: Partnerships that align payer reimbursement incentives with provider quality outcomes and technology solutions that improve patient health while reducing costs.
Population Health Management: Collaborative approaches that combine payer claims data, provider clinical information, and digital health monitoring to improve population health outcomes and reduce healthcare costs.
Risk Sharing Models: Partnership structures where payers, providers, and technology companies share financial risk and reward based on patient outcome improvements and cost reductions achieved through integrated digital health solutions.
Chronic Disease Management Programs: Comprehensive partnerships that address chronic disease management through integrated care delivery, digital monitoring, and outcome-based reimbursement models.

Overcoming Common Partnership Challenges in Digital Health
Intellectual Property and Competitive Concerns
Digital health partnerships must navigate complex intellectual property and competitive issues:
IP Ownership Clarity: Establishing clear agreements about intellectual property ownership and licensing rights that protect all partners while enabling collaborative innovation.
Competitive Boundary Management: Creating partnership structures that enable collaboration while maintaining appropriate competitive boundaries and market position protection.
Technology Integration Standards: Developing technical standards and integration protocols that enable interoperability while protecting proprietary technologies and competitive advantages.
Regulatory Compliance and Risk Management
Healthcare partnerships must address complex regulatory requirements and risk allocation:
Multi-Organization Compliance: Ensuring regulatory compliance across all partner organizations while maintaining operational efficiency and innovation capability.
Risk Sharing Frameworks: Developing risk allocation models that appropriately distribute liability and regulatory responsibility among partnership participants.
Data Privacy and Security: Creating comprehensive data governance frameworks that protect patient privacy and ensure security across all partner organizations and technology platforms.
Cultural Integration and Change Management
Successful partnerships require effective cultural integration and change management:
Organizational Culture Alignment: Addressing cultural differences between startup innovation culture and established healthcare system operations through structured integration and communication programs.
Change Management: Implementing comprehensive change management strategies that help healthcare providers and patients adapt to new digital health solutions and collaborative care models.
Staff Training and Development: Creating training programs that enable healthcare providers and administrative staff to effectively utilize partnership-developed digital health solutions.
